Transaction 50fa860bd9aaca05ef2bcbe4e368ff63139270131466fe4283c1659184116c5a

1 Input
2 Outputs
  • 50fa860bd9aaca05ef2bcbe4e368ff63139270131466fe4283c1659184116c5a:0
  • value  613626
    address  1EsnbFFeKRoVWdfSES1YHbjnGwPvmtBJr8
  • 50fa860bd9aaca05ef2bcbe4e368ff63139270131466fe4283c1659184116c5a:1
  • value  2222505
    address  3EhMcQ4gfNi5Z9aqtfRBb5Ba4NCc58tae9